Barnes & Noble is expanding its presence in Fort Worth . The bookstore chain previously had three locations in the city, and with the addition of a new store, it will soon have three again. This number does not include the location at Texas Christian University, which is focused on serving the university community.
Further details about the new location are available from the Texas Department of Licensing and Regulation, where the company recently filed a plan. The New York-based company's plans for the new store are outlined in the filing, providing more information for those interested in learning more about the upcoming addition to Fort Worth's retail scene.
